Damage at the level of the roof framing

The structure, which can be made of wood, iron or reinforced concrete, is formed by elements that make up the skeleton of the roof. On this framing, it is installed the roof cover.

What damage may occur at this level? First of all, for optimal support of the covering materials, the framing must be very solid and resistant. The problems arise especially in the case of wooden structures and concern two aspects: humidity and pests. In conditions of extreme moisture, wood can rot. It may also be attacked by pests (wood destroying insects and fungus) that could compromise the structure of the roof – a situation that is potentially very dangerous, unless addressed in time.  

Roof cover damage

The cover represents the visible part of the roof, which can be made of ceramic tile, bituminous shingles, metal shingles concrete tiles, etc.

According to recommended roofing Lincoln NE companies, the choice of poor-quality materials, the age of the roof, lack of maintenance but also extreme weather phenomena can cause the following problems to occur:

  • water infiltration at the upper level of the house
  • the appearance of mold and high level of moisture due to these infiltrations
  • weakening of the strength structure of the house and of the roof framing
  • thermal insulation and poor waterproofing, reflected in low thermal comfort
  • unsightly external appearance of the roof, due to discoloration (especially as a result of poor resistance to UV radiation)

Damage to the pluvial system

It is the rainwater system that contributes to the drainage and safe evacuation of water from the roof. It typically consists of gutters and downspouts.

Damage to the rainwater system can adversely affect the covering materials and the resistance structure of the house, and may consist of:

  • loose downspouts or parts of the gutters
  • insufficient resistance to high loads, which results in poor water drainage
  • lack of correct merging of component elements
  • because rainwater does not drain optimally, it may stagnate on the roof and affect its surface, or leak down along the walls, favoring their degradation, infiltrating in the basement etc.
